Moss Bluff, La., March 4, 2024 — Fastwyre now powered by Swyft Fiber, a premier provider of high-speed, ultra-reliable and affordable fiber optic networks spanning America, has invested over $65 million toward bolstering network enhancements and new market expansions in Louisiana regions. Previously operating as Cameron Communications, which has served Southwest and South Central Louisiana residents and businesses for nearly a century, the company has evolved into Fastwyre now powered by Swyft Fiber, revolutionizing internet accessibility. Areas including Moss Bluff, Cameron Parish, Carlyss, DeRidder, Elizabeth, Grand Lake, Leesville, Oakdale, Pitkin, Sugartown and Westlake will enjoy faster, more reliable and super affordable internet with speeds from 2 gigabits up to 10 gigabits per second, which surpasses those of nearby city hubs, ensuring unparalleled connectivity for years to come.

Fastwyre now powered by Swyft Fiber’s highly reliable and resilient network features a state-of-the-art, fiber-to-the-premises infrastructure enhancement. “Our network enables residents and businesses to experience the ease of equally fast uploads and downloads of rich content, such as sharing multimedia files or streaming video,” says Kevin Caldwell, General Manager of Fastwyre now powered by Swyft Fiber’s South Central Region. “Delivering speeds of up to 2 gigabits per second, with future plans to escalate to 10 gigabits per second, our network powers e-commerce, virtual learning, agricultural technology, telehealth and entertainment at very affordable rates, from $44.99 per month for speeds up to 100 megabits per second, to $69.99 a month for speeds up to 1 gigabits per second.”

About Fastwyre now powered by Swyft Fiber

American Broadband Holding Company dba Fastwyre now powered by Swyft Fiber is a premier provider of broadband services delivering affordable, reliable, high-speed internet services to communities across America. The Company provides internet, phone, and video to customers in Louisiana, Missouri, Alabama, Alaska, Nebraska and Texas. Fastwyre now powered by Swyft Fiber partners in the growth and economic vitality of its communities by providing broadband and other advanced services to support new business activity and job growth.

Fastwyre now powered by Swyft Fiber is a portfolio company of Madison Dearborn Partners, LLC, a leading private equity firm based in Chicago, and Catania ABC Partners.
